Alrighty, folks, gather ’round for some juicy deets! So, check it out – there’s this swanky dinner happening in Washington, D.C. on May 22, 2025, with none other than ex-President Donald Trump. And guess who’s snagged an invite? None other than Nikita Anufriev, the big shot behind the Russian-language crypto podcast and community, “Headliners.”
This exclusive shindig is only for the top 220 holders of the new crypto token, $TRUMP, and it’s causing quite the stir in the media. Apparently, these VIPs dropped a cool $148 million to rub elbows with the Donald himself. Anufriev was quick to jump on the $TRUMP bandwagon, predicting its rise to fame when it first hit the market at $1.7 per token. And wouldn’t you know it, just two days later, that bad boy shot up to $75.35, making waves with a market cap of over $15 billion.
In Anufriev’s own words, this invite isn’t just about him – it’s a nod to the whole “Headliners” crew. He’s all about those connections, seeing this dinner as a golden opportunity on a global scale. This guy’s been in the IT game since 2013, co-founding the wildly popular Hamster Kombat app that blew up to 350 million users in under three months. Now, he’s all about the crypto scene, running “Headliners” and repping the Hash Hedge trading platform.
